Registered trademark of The Lutheran Church—Missouri Synod. Can there be any stronger symbol of Christian identity than the cross? Surely it is symbolic of the despair and grief of sin. Yet as an empty cross, it is symbolic of hope, joy, and promise that God himself suffered and overcame the wages of sin through Jesus Christ. The logo for The Lutheran Church—Missouri Synod appropriately continues the symbolism of the cross. Three crosses are yet one cross, recalling the "Unity in Trinity and the Trinity in Unity" confessed in the Athanasian Creed.

Gift Book Donations 

Donations are welcome. The Library Committee upon evaluation of any item will decide if the material fits into the mission of the Library and the selection policy. Gift materials accepted for inclusion in the Library are subject to the same selection criteria as items purchased. All materials should be in usable condition. If the owner wishes to have the item returned, if not included in the Library’s collection, a name should be included with each item. If not added to the Library collection, donations may be used in an annual book sale to benefit the Library or donated to a local charity such as the Jimmie Hale Mission, The Salvation Army, etc.
